From Honolulu to Washington, D.C., the former punk frontman with the ridiculously long resume has announced that he'll be visiting all 50 state capitals with his spoken word performances.    

"It's just me and what's left of my intellect," Henry says. "I just call it a 'talking show,' because that's all I do." 

With his first stop in Honolulu, Hawaii on September 6th, Henry will hike around the country until his final show in Washington, D.C. on November 5th.

"We will be going all the way up to election eve," Henry says. "It's always a great time to be in America, but this will be the high point of this year's tour. Shepard Fairey did a great poster for the tour to make it extra noteworthy. I can't wait to start this one."
